Linux服务器数据库是指运行在Linux操作系统上的数据库软件。数据库是一个用于存储、管理和检索数据的集合,它提供了一种结构化的方式来组织和访问数据。Linux服务器数据库可以基于不同的数据库管理系统(DBMS)实现,例如MySQL、PostgreSQL、MongoDB等。
- MySQL:
- 概念:MySQL是一种开源的关系型数据库管理系统,它支持多用户、多线程和多个存储引擎。
- 分类:MySQL属于关系型数据库管理系统(RDBMS)。
- 优势:具有良好的性能、稳定性和可扩展性,拥有丰富的功能和广泛的社区支持。
- 应用场景:适用于各种规模的应用,包括Web应用、企业应用、数据仓库等。
- 腾讯云产品:云数据库MySQL是腾讯云提供的托管式MySQL数据库服务,具有高可用、弹性扩展、自动备份等特性。详情请参考:云数据库MySQL
- PostgreSQL:
- 概念:PostgreSQL是一个强大的开源关系型数据库管理系统,它具有高度可扩展性、安全性和数据完整性。
- 分类:PostgreSQL属于关系型数据库管理系统(RDBMS)。
- 优势:支持复杂查询和高级数据类型,具有良好的可扩展性和数据一致性。
- 应用场景:适用于需要高级功能和复杂数据模型的应用,如地理信息系统(GIS)、金融应用等。
- 腾讯云产品:云数据库PostgreSQL是腾讯云提供的托管式PostgreSQL数据库服务,具有高可用、安全可靠等特性。详情请参考:云数据库PostgreSQL
- MongoDB:
- 概念:MongoDB是一个开源的文档型NoSQL数据库,它使用类似JSON的BSON格式来存储数据。
- 分类:MongoDB属于文档型数据库。
- 优势:具有灵活的数据模型和可扩展性,支持高性能的读写操作和复杂的查询。
- 应用场景:适用于需要处理半结构化数据、大规模数据存储和实时分析的应用,如物联网、日志分析等。
- 腾讯云产品:云数据库MongoDB是腾讯云提供的托管式MongoDB数据库服务,具有高可用、弹性扩展等特性。详情请参考:云数据库MongoDB
需要注意的是,选择合适的数据库取决于具体应用需求,每种数据库都有自己的特点和适用场景。以上介绍的腾讯云产品仅作为参考,建议根据实际情况进行选择和部署。